干扰素调节因子5、粒细胞-巨噬细胞集落刺激因子在细菌性肺炎病儿血清中的表达及预后价值

Expression and prognostic value of IRF5 and GM-CSF in serum of children with bacterial pneumonia

摘要 目的探讨干扰素调节因子5(interferon regulatory factor 5,IRF5)、粒细胞-巨噬细胞集落刺激因子(granulocyte-macro-phage colony-stimulating factor,GM-CSF)在细菌性肺炎病儿血清中的表达变化及疾病预后价值。方法选取2019年4月至2021年5月中国人民解放军联勤保障部队第九二八医院收治的细菌感染性肺炎病儿96例作为细菌组,同期非细菌感染性肺炎病儿88例作为非细菌组,另外选取健康体检儿童96例为对照组,收集检测三组病儿基本临床资料。检测血清中IRF5、GM-CSF及其组间差异;采用Pearson法分析细菌性肺炎病儿血清IRF5、GM-CSF水平与病情指标的相关性;应用受试者操作特征曲线(ROC曲线)分析IRF5、GM-CSF及二者联合预测细菌性肺炎预后的价值。结果细菌组血清IRF5水平[(38.85±13.86)ng/L]显著高于非细菌组[(11.15±4.37)ng/L]和对照组[(10.76±1.55)ng/L],且重症组高于轻症组(P<0.05);细菌组血清GM-CSF水平[(54.73±16.56)ng/L]显著低于非细菌组[(246.73±28.94)ng/L]和对照组[(250.64±55.67)ng/L],且重症组低于轻症组(P<0.05)。重症组气促、吐沫、三凹征、肺部明显湿啰音比例、C反应蛋白(C-reactive protein,CRP)、白细胞水平显著高于轻症组、非细菌组(P<0.05),轻症组、非细菌组CRP水平显著高于对照组(P<0.05),非细菌组CRP水平显著高于对照组(P<0.05)。血清IRF5水平与CRP、白细胞、临床肺部感染评分(clinical pulmonary infection score,CPIS)均呈正相关(r=0.34、0.36、0.41,P<0.05),血清GM-CSF水平与CRP、白细胞、CPIS均呈负相关(r=-0.40、-0.32、-0.45,P<0.05)。预后不良组血清IRF5水平高于预后良好组,血清GM-CSF水平低于预后良好组(P<0.05)。ROC曲线显示,IRF5、GM-CSF对预后预测的AUC分别为0.90、0.87,二者联合对预后预测的AUC为0.96,明显高于二者单独诊断,(Z联合vs.IRF5=2.86,P=0.004;Z联合vs.GM-CSF=2.24,P=0.025),其灵敏度、特异度分别为90.32%、90.77%。结论细菌性肺炎病儿血清IRF5水平升高,GM-CSF水平降低,二者在评估病情进展及疾病预后预测方面具有较高的价值。 Objective To investigate the expression changes of interferon regulatory factor 5(IRF5)and granulocyte-macrophage colony-stimulating factor(GM-CSF)in serum of children with bacterial pneumonia and their prognostic value.Methods From April 2019 to May 2021,Ninety-six children with bacterial pneumonia,who were admitted to The 928th Hospital of the Joint Logistics Support Force of the People´s Liberation Army of China,were included as the bacterial group.Meantime,88 children with non-bacterial pneumonia were included as the non-bacterial group.In addition,96 healthy children were chosen as the control group.The basic clinical data of the three groups were collected and detected.Serum IRF5 and GM-CSF were detected and the differences between groups were compared.Pearson´s correlation coefficient was applied to analyze the correlation between serum IRF5 and GM-CSF levels and disease indicators in children with bacterial pneumonia;ROC curve was applied to analyze the values of IRF5,GM-CSF and their combination in predicting the prognosis of bacterial pneumonia.Results The serum IRF5 level[(38.85±13.86)ng/L]in the bacterial group was obviously higher than that in the non-bacterial group[(11.15±4.37)ng/L]and the control group[(10.76±1.55)ng/L],and the severe group higher than the mild group(P<0.05);the serum GM-CSF level[(54.73±16.56)ng/L]in the bacterial group was obviously lower than that in the non-bacterial group[(246.73±28.94)ng/L]and the control group[(250.64±55.67)ng/L],and the severe group was lower than the mild group(P<0.05).The severe group had obviously higher proportions of shortness of breath,spit,three concave signs,the obvious moist rales in the lungs,and levels of C-reactive protein(CRP),white blood cell(WBC)than the mild group and the non-bacterial group(P<0.05),and the mild group and non-bacterial group had obviously higher levels of CRP than the control group(P<0.05),the level of CRP in the non-bacterial group significantly higher than that in the control group(P<0.05).Serum IRF5 level was positively correlated with CRP,WBC,and pulmonary infection score(CPIS)(r=0.34,0.36,0.41,respectively;P<0.05),and serum GM-CSF level was negatively correlated with CRP,WBC,and CPIS scores(r=−0.40,−0.32,−0.45,respectively;P<0.05).The serum IRF5 level in the poor prognosis group was higher than that in the good prognosis group,and the serum GM-CSF level was lower than that in the good prognosis group(P<0.05).The ROC curve showed that the AUCs of IRF5 and GM-CSF for prognosis prediction were 0.90 and 0.87,respectively,and the AUC of the combination of the two was 0.96,which was obviously higher than that of the two alone,(Z combined vs.IRF5=2.86,P=0.004;Z combined vs.GM-CSF=2.24,P=0.025),and the sensitivity and specificity were 90.32%and 90.77%,respectively.Conclusion Serum IRF5 level is increased and GM-CSF level is decreased in children with bacterial pneumonia,both of which have high value in evaluating disease progression and predicting disease prognosis.
